Cognitive Science Faculty Reading Group

Interested Cornell faculty have formed a summer reading group and, so far, have been through the following works:

wider than the sky: The Phenomenal Gift of Consciousness by Gerald Edelman
a devil's chaplain: Reflections on Hope, Lies, Science, and Love by Richard Dawkins
How the Mind Works by Steven Pinker
The Engine of Reason, The Seat of the Soul: A Philosophical Journey into the Brain by Paul Churchland
